Output 30e3a521ea0cd3624e696a2fab1d93f76fbb098ee3ba82b63d0d278394499b48:11

value
64552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cd86cd6d3300d2c176e93bde1b9d959f2df0978 OP_EQUAL
address
38hLYc7EhXWpoQRhXr83Z5hrMNN7VrDmYN
transaction
30e3a521ea0cd3624e696a2fab1d93f76fbb098ee3ba82b63d0d278394499b48
spent
true